15 Years Ago, Bees In Brooklyn Appeared Red After Snacking Where They Shouldn’tIn the summer of 2010, not long after beekeeping was made legal in New York City, a mysterious phenomenon arose in the hives of Red Hook, Brooklyn. As though living up to the colorful part of the neighborhood’s name, bright red bees began buzzing around. So too were their hives dripping with red, instead of the usual...
